# Break-Glass: Catalog Cache Invalidation

Scope: the Pinrow product catalog at Veldstone Retail. If stale prices persist after a purge and the Hollowmere invalidation queue is wedged, use break-glass to flush the edge tier directly. Contractors: get verbal sign-off from the catalog lead first. Steps: open the Hollowmere admin shell, select emergency-flush, confirm the tenant, and run it once — repeated flushes thrash the origin. Access is logged and expires after 20 minutes. Unseal the admin shell with the passphrase below.

recovery phrase for kahop-tajog: istix-casvan

Subject: DR drill Thursday — cold starts. Hey Mira, heads up for the Fenwick Cloud drill: we're killing all warm serverless handlers to measure cold-start latency on checkout. Expect the first few invocations to crawl. If the orchestrator locks you out mid-drill, don't panic — just restore access with the recovery passphrase below.

recovery phrase for fajep-yaweg: gilath-sorox-wenius-rusdor-keliel-zorius

**Alert: `thumbforge` batch resize queue stalled**

This alert indicates the thumbforge CLI worker has processed zero images for fifteen consecutive minutes while items remain queued. Common causes include malformed source files and exhausted temp-disk space on the Larkspur render hosts. Please do not restart the worker before capturing its logs. Detailed triage steps are maintained on the internal page here:

runbook for badug-kadup: https://confluence.zemvarlabs.internal/projects/browse/display/projects/bd1b

Hi Marta,

Handing over the string-extraction script for the Tollbridge app. It runs nightly, pulls translatable strings from the templates, and pushes them to the Lindenwell translation queue. Watch for duplicate-key warnings; they usually mean a merge went sideways. The script's output bundle must be signed before upload, so use the key below.

rollout seal: bky4_x7Gc

Runbook: account recovery — Relaygate webhooks. If a customer account is locked and their webhook endpoints are stuck in retry, note that Relaygate retries 6 times with jittered backoff (30s base, capped at 15m) before dead-lettering. Pause the retry scheduler for the affected tenant first, then run the recovery flow from the admin shell. The flow will prompt once for the recovery passphrase, shown directly below.

unlock words, yawig-kagef: gordor-holvan-ulaael-pramir-ulaiel-tamdor